This City, in office worker central, creates unisex appeal by marrying mirrors, mood lighting and glam wallpaper with chesterfield-style couches, TVs and a pool table. The menu is equally tuned into the feminine and masculine sides of the dining population, offering salads and gluten-free options as well as steaks and burgers. Thinly sliced beetroot and vodka-cured salmon was a little lacklustre but the accompanying potato pancakes and creme fraiche brought the dish together, while the trio of pork - belly, home-made sausage and fillet - was given lift-off with glazed apple pieces. Neat portion sizes mean there's no danger of blowing the diet.
